5: Preparing the receiver
and the remote

If your receiver has a voltage selector on the
rear panel, check that the voltage selector is set
to the local power supply voltage. If not, use a
screwdriver to set the selector to the correct
position before connecting the AC power cord
to a wall outlet.

Connect the AC power cord to a wall outlet.

Before using the receiver for the first time,
initialize the receiver by performing the
following procedure. This procedure can also
be used to return settings you have made to
their factory defaults.
Be sure to use the buttons on the receiver for
this operation.

1

Press ?/1 to turn off the
receiver.

2

Hold down ?/1 for 5 seconds.

After “CLEARING” appears on the
display for a while, “CLEARED”
appears.
The following items are reset to their
factory settings.
• All settings in the LEVEL, TONE,

SUR, TUNER, AUDIO and SYSTEM
menus.

• The sound field memorized for each

input and preset station.

• All sound field parameters.
• All preset stations.
• All index names for inputs and preset

stations.

• MASTER VOLUME is set to “VOL

MIN”.

• Input is set to “DVD”.
